UN Report Exposes Surge in Violence Against Muslims ​and Refugees in Central â£African Republic
A recent report by the United Nations has unveiled alarming statistics and harrowing⣠accounts of violence against ​muslims and refugees in the†Central African Republic (CAR). According to the findings, the contry has witnessed a sharp⢠increase in â¢attacks, exacerbated by†deep-rooted ethnic tensions and ongoing conflicts. The⣠UN has documented numerous incidents characterized by †brutality, including armed assaults,⣠forced displacement, and targeted killings. ‌Local communities are reportedly living in constant fear, with​ many feeling unsafe in their own⢠neighborhoods. The report emphasizes â£the dire need for international attention and intervention to protect vulnerable populations.
The humanitarian crisis is further complicated by‌ inadequate access⣠to essential services and⣠poor living conditions. â¤Many refugees and displaced individuals face dire choices as they seek safety, frequently enough leading to overcrowded camps that lack basic necessities. Key highlights from‌ the report include:
- Surge in Attacks: A reported 150% increase in ethnic violence against Muslim â¢communities in recent months.
- Displacement⢠Crisis: Over‌ 300,000 people have been ​forcibly displaced due to conflict, ​with a notable portion being Muslims.
- Humanitarian Access: Only 50% of refugees have timely access to food and healthcare services.
